TRG Screen Builds a Trusted, Automated ARR Reporting Engine with Discern

Overview

TRG Screen, a Vista Equity Partners portfolio company, operates a complex, multi-product SaaS business serving global financial institutions. With hundreds of customers, evolving contract structures, and highly specific investor reporting requirements, maintaining a consistent and reliable view of ARR is critical to how the business measures performance and plans for growth.

As the business scaled, TRG Screen saw an opportunity to modernize how ARR was calculated and reported — moving from manual processes toward a more systemized, scalable approach. By implementing Discern, the team established a centralized layer across Salesforce and ERP systems, enabling them to codify business logic, unify historical and current data, and produce consistent, investor-grade reporting.

The result is a trusted source of truth for ARR that reduces manual effort while providing clearer insight into growth drivers, product performance, and long-term trends.

The Challenge

Like many growing SaaS companies, TRG Screen’s ARR reporting had evolved over time, with spreadsheets playing a central role in calculations and analysis. While flexible, this approach made it more difficult to maintain consistency and scalability as the business expanded.

At the same time, the company was preparing for a major ERP transition from Sage Intacct to NetSuite, introducing additional complexity around maintaining historical continuity while standing up new reporting processes.

As a Vista portfolio company, TRG Screen also operates with highly specific investor reporting requirements, including detailed attribution of ARR changes across upsell, cross-sell, and price increases.

Spreadsheets worked, but they made it harder to ensure consistency and confidence in how ARR was being calculated month to month.

The Solution

TRG Screen implemented Discern as a centralized calculation and integration layer, connecting Salesforce, Sage Intacct, and NetSuite into a single, reliable reporting framework.

Discern enabled the team to codify ARR logic, tailored to TRG Screen’s specific business rules — while automating monthly calculations and ARR waterfall reporting. During the ERP migration, Discern also served as a bridge between historical Sage data and new NetSuite data, ensuring continuity without requiring a full data migration.

The platform’s flexibility allows the team to handle real-world complexity, such as delayed renewals, non-standard contract structures, and edge-case adjustments, while maintaining consistent, rules-based outputs.

Business Impact

By moving to a rules-based, automated approach, TRG Screen significantly improved both efficiency and confidence in its ARR reporting.

Month-end ARR processes were reduced from 20–30 hours to just 3–5 hours, freeing up FP&A bandwidth for higher-value analysis. At the same time, codified logic improved transparency and consistency, strengthening both internal and investor-facing reporting.

Discern also enables more precise attribution of ARR changes, giving stakeholders clearer visibility into how the business is growing across upsell, cross-sell, and pricing dynamics.

Key outcomes include:

  • Faster monthly close: Month-end ARR reporting dropped from 20–30 hours to 3–5 hours.
  • Consistent, rules-based logic: Codified ARR rules improved transparency and month-to-month consistency.
  • Precise ARR attribution: Clearer visibility into growth across upsell, cross-sell, and price increases.
  • Continuity through ERP migration: Bridged historical Sage Intacct and new NetSuite data — no full data migration required.
  • Investor-grade confidence: A trusted ARR source of truth that meets Vista’s investor reporting requirements.

About TRG Screen

TRG Screen is the leading provider of software used to monitor and manage subscription spend & usage across the entire enterprise. TRG Screen is differentiated by its ability to comprehensively monitor both spend on & usage of data and information services including market data, research, software licensing, and other corporate expenses to optimize enterprise subscriptions, for a global client base.

TRG Screen’s clients realize immediate ROI and significant long-term cost savings, transparency into their purchased subscriptions, workflow improvements and a higher degree of compliance with their vendor contracts. Its global client base consists of more than 750 financial institutions, law firms, professional services firms and other blue-chip enterprises that jointly manage more than $8.5 billion of subscription spend using TRG Screen’s software solutions.

TRG was founded in 1998 by a group of financial technology executives passionate about helping firms manage their high-value data subscriptions, and joined Vista Equity Partners in 2024.
